Delen via


Bepalen welke versie en editie van SQL Server Database Engine wordt uitgevoerd

Oorspronkelijke productversie: SQL Server
Oorspronkelijk KB-nummer: 321185

Samenvatting

De sql Server Database Engine-versie en -editie zijn essentieel voor het oplossen van problemen, het plannen van upgrades en het garanderen van compatibiliteit met andere onderdelen. In dit artikel worden verschillende methoden uitgelegd om deze informatie te vinden, waaronder SQL Server Management Studio (SSMS), foutenlogboekbestanden, T-SQL-query's en het SQL Server-installatiecentrum.

Notitie

De versie-informatie volgt het major.minor.build.revision patroon. De revisiegegevens worden doorgaans niet gebruikt wanneer u de SQL Server-versie controleert.

Kies uw methode om de versie en editie te bepalen

Methode Ideaal voor Requirements
Objectverkenner (SSMS) Snelle visuele controle SSMS geïnstalleerd, serververbinding
Foutenlogboekbestand Geen verbinding nodig Toegang tot bestandssysteem
SELECT @@VERSION Scripting en automatisering Querytoegang
SERVERPROPERTY Afzonderlijke eigenschapswaarden Querytoegang
Detectierapport Alle instanties op het systeem Alleen lokale toegang

Objectverkenner gebruiken in SQL Server Management Studio

Maak verbinding met de server met behulp van Objectverkenner in SQL Server Management Studio (SSMS). Nadat u verbinding hebt gemaakt, worden de versiegegevens tussen haakjes weergegeven, samen met de gebruikersnaam die u hebt gebruikt om verbinding te maken met het specifieke exemplaar van SQL Server.

Zie Verbinding maken met een SQL Server of Azure SQL Database voor meer informatie over het maken van verbinding met SQL Server met behulp van Object Explorer.

Het foutenlogboekbestand weergeven

Controleer de eerste paar regels van het Errorlog bestand voor dat exemplaar. Standaard bevindt het foutenlogboek zich Program Files\Microsoft SQL Server\MSSQL.n\MSSQL\LOG\ERRORLOG in ERRORLOG.n bestanden. De vermeldingen lijken mogelijk op het volgende voorbeeld:

2024-09-05 16:56:22.35 Server      Microsoft SQL Server 2022 (RTM-CU14) (KB5038325) - 16.0.4135.4 (X64)  
Jul 10 2024 14:09:09  
Copyright (C) 2022 Microsoft Corporation 
Developer Edition (64-bit) on Windows 11 Enterprise 10.0 <X64> (Build 22631: ) (Hypervisor)

Deze vermelding bevat productinformatie, zoals versie, productniveau, 64-bits versus 32-bits architectuur, de SQL Server-editie en de versie van het besturingssysteem waarop SQL Server wordt uitgevoerd.

De SELECT @@VERSION-query uitvoeren

Maak verbinding met het exemplaar van SQL Server en voer vervolgens de volgende query uit:

SELECT @@VERSION

In het volgende voorbeeld ziet u de uitvoer van deze query:

Microsoft SQL Server 2022 (RTM-CU14) (KB5038325) - 16.0.4135.4 (X64)   Jul 10 2024 14:09:09   Copyright (C) 2022 Microsoft Corporation  Developer Edition (64-bit) on Windows 11 Enterprise 10.0 <X64> (Build 22631: ) (Hypervisor) 

In de uitvoer kunt u de sql Server-productversie, het servicepackniveau , het cumulatieve updateniveau of het beveiligingsupdateniveau (indien van toepassing) identificeren.

De functie SERVERPROPERTY gebruiken

Maak verbinding met het exemplaar van SQL Server en voer vervolgens de volgende query uit in SSMS:

SELECT SERVERPROPERTY('productversion'), SERVERPROPERTY('productlevel'), SERVERPROPERTY('edition')

Deze query retourneert de volgende resultaten:

  • De productversie (bijvoorbeeld 16.0.4135.4)
  • Het productniveau (bijvoorbeeld RTM)
  • De editie (bijvoorbeeld Developer)

De resultaten kunnen er bijvoorbeeld als volgt uitzien:

Productversie Productniveau Editie
16.0.4135.4 RTM Developer Edition (64-bits)

Notitie

Het detectierapport voor geïnstalleerde SQL Server-functies gebruiken

Zoek het detectierapport voor geïnstalleerde SQL Server-functies op de pagina Hulpprogramma's van het Installatiecentrum voor SQL Server. Dit rapport bevat informatie over alle SQL Server-exemplaren die op het systeem zijn geïnstalleerd, inclusief clienthulpprogramma's zoals SSMS. Dit hulpprogramma wordt alleen lokaal uitgevoerd op het systeem waarop SQL Server is geïnstalleerd. Er kan geen informatie worden opgehaald over externe servers.

Zie Een SQL Server-installatie valideren voor meer informatie.

In de volgende afbeelding ziet u een voorbeeldrapport:

Schermopname van een voorbeeld van een SQL Server 2016 Setup Discovery-rapport.